Trucksville, Pennsylvania gets 42 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38 inches of rain per year.

Trucksville averages 38 inches of snow per year. The US average is 28 inches of snow per year.

On average, there are 176 sunny days per year in Trucksville.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Trucksville gets some kind of precipitation, on average, 129 days per year. Precipitation is rain, snow, sleet, or hail that falls to the ground. In order for precipitation to be counted you have to get at least .01 inches on the ground to measure.

Bestplaces Comfort Index

The annual BestPlaces Comfort Index for Trucksville is 6.8 (10=best), which means it is less comfortable than most places in Pennsylvania.

9.1 Summer - 4.6 Winter
August, July and June are the most pleasant months in Trucksville, while January and February are the least comfortable months.

Many people confuse weather and climate but they are different. Weather is the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, and climate is how the atmosphere is over long periods of time.

Weather is how the atmosphere is behaving and its effects upon life and human activities. Weather can change from minute-to-minute. Most people think of weather in terms of temperature, humidity, precipitation, cloudiness, brightness, visibility, wind, and atmospheric pressure.

Climate is the description of the long-term pattern of weather in a place. Climate can mean the average weather for a particular region and time period taken over 30 years. Climate is the average of weather over time.

July is the hottest month for Trucksville with an average high temperature of 80.5°, which ranks it as cooler than most places in Pennsylvania. In Trucksville,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Trucksville are August, June and July.
In Trucksville, there are 4.0 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is cooler than most places in Pennsylvania.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Trucksville with an average of 15.9°. This is colder than most places in Pennsylvania.
In Trucksville, there are 141.2 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is colder than most places in Pennsylvania.
In Trucksville, there are 5.1 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is colder than most places in Pennsylvania.
Humidity in Trucksville is generally low and comfortable. But there some days when the humidity becomes unpleasant, especially in July and August. The most humid months (but still comfortable) are July, August and June.
September is the wettest month in Trucksville with 4.4 inches of rain, and the driest month is February with 2.2 inches. The wettest season is Autumn with 29% of yearly precipitation and 19%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 41.7 inches in Trucksville means that it is drier than most places in Pennsylvania.
May is the rainiest month in Trucksville with 12.3 days of rain, and February is the driest month with only 9.5 rainy days. There are 129.4 rainy days annually in Trucksville, which is about average compared to other places in Pennsylvania. The rainiest season is Summer when it rains 27% of the time and the driest is Winter with only a 23% chance of a rainy day.
An annual snowfall of 37.9 inches in Trucksville means that it is snowier than most places in Pennsylvania. January is the snowiest month in Trucksville with 12.9 inches of snow, and 6 months of the year have significant snowfall.
